Who keeps the original rental agreement?
I am a tenant who recently signed a rental agreement with a landlord. I am curious as to who keeps the original agreement, as I was not given a copy of the agreement after signing. I would like to know if I am entitled to receive a copy of the document and who will be responsible for keeping the original agreement.
Merry A.
It is customary for the landlord to keep the original. WA State Law requires the landlord to give the tenant a copy: https://apps.leg.wa.gov/rcw/default.aspx?cite=59.18.065

Are there automatic renewals in rental agreements?
I am looking to rent a property and have read the rental agreement, however, I am unsure if there are any automatic renewals in the agreement. I have heard that sometimes rental agreements are set up to automatically renew after a certain period of time, but I am not sure if this is the case with my agreement. I am looking for clarity on whether or not the agreement I am signing includes any automatic renewals.
Merry A.
Residential month to month rental agreements and/or residential lease agreements often include terms regarding whether or not an agreement automatically renews. However, the Washington State Residential Landlord Tenant Law and/or ordinances in certain WA cities sometimes may provide the answer to your question. https://apps.leg.wa.gov/rcw/default.aspx?cite=59.18
